We are interested in the Rose family in Rockland County and our preliminary research is on file at the Rockland Room at the New City Library dating from Jan. 1993. The Roses in northern Rockland were probably mostly descendants of Jacob Rose (approx 1740 to 1803) who had seven sons. Each of them had 5-10 children. The place populated up fast. The eldest also named Jacob (approx 1770 to 1859) and a number of others were named Jacob. Mary Rose born about 1810 (I cannot recall her parentage right now) appears to have been married to George Weiant. they may have lived up that way. Ruben Brown Ruben Brown
